Why You Need an Asbestos Attorney Lawyer

A mesothelioma lawyer can help asbestos victims receive financial compensation. asbestos claim victims should seek legal assistance through national firms that specialize asbestos cases.

A reputable mesothelioma law company offers free assessments of your case to determine whether you are eligible for compensation. In addition, the top mesothelioma attorneys work on a contingent basis. This helps maximize the amount of compensation a client receives.

1. Experience

If you or someone you know has mesothelioma, asbestosis or other asbestos-related illness, it is important to hire an experienced lawyer to help you get compensation. Asbestos-related sufferers may sue companies for exposing them to asbestos. This will cover their financial losses.

asbestos claim victims are given a limited amount of time to file a claim, or face the possibility of being denied the right to take legal actions. A knowledgeable New York asbestos attorney can assist you in filing your claim within the legal deadlines, and ensure that all relevant laws are followed.

Mesothelioma lawyers have experience with the complex rules and regulations surrounding asbestos litigation. They also have the skills necessary to gather evidence and create a convincing argument before judges and juries. A lawyer who is highly rated has a track record of helping their clients obtain full and fair compensation for their losses.

Many of the nation's top mesothelioma lawyers have offices in New York, including Weitz & Luxenberg, Cooney & Conway, and Simmons Hanly Conroy. They have a team consisting of paralegals and attorneys who can help you file a lawsuit against asbestos in the state most likely to be successful.

asbestos lawsuit litigation is a national practice, and most large mesothelioma law companies have national reach. However, it is essential to hire an asbestos attorney who has local offices and who can meet with you in person if it is possible. Local offices let you be more comfortable in discussing your case, and can make the process easier by removing some of the anxiety that comes with traveling.

If you're interviewing candidates ask each about their experience in asbestos case litigation. Ask about the firm's strategy for each case and how it plans to fight on your behalf. Be sure to inquire about who will be handling your case (non-lawyer case managers are typically employed by larger companies), and how long it takes them to respond to phone or email calls.

A mesothelioma verdict or settlement can cover medical bills and lost wages, home care costs as well as travel expenses, funeral and burial costs, and other expenses. Many victims receive millions of dollars in compensation.

2. Reputation

If you want to ensure the best possible outcome for your mesothelioma case you should consider hiring a law firm that has a national presence and a wealth of experience. These asbestos firms are specialized and have a deep understanding of asbestos litigation (www.diywiki.org), and how it differs by state. This simplified process will save you time and stress when you seek compensation. This lets you focus more on your family, and medical treatment, rather than trying to navigate the legal process.

Attorneys with a solid reputation have a track record of obtaining compensation for victims and families. They have access to numerous resources, including industry statistics and historical information. They have the experience and experience to identify asbestos companies that are responsible and file an action in the form of a trust fund or lawsuit. These lawyers are driven for justice and the desire to hold asbestos manufacturers accountable for their blunders. For instance, the renowned asbestos lawyer Joseph D. Satterley has an intimate connection to the disease due to his grandfather's diagnosis of mesothelioma. He has won several multimillion-dollar verdicts in mesothelioma cases, including the first verdict by a jury ever against Colgate-Palmolive for its renowned Cashmere Bouquet Talcum Powder.

The ideal mesothelioma attorney has a positive outlook and be attentive to your concerns and be able to answer questions in a timely manner. He or she can explain the various options available for financial compensation, including filing mesothelioma lawsuits, trust fund claims, and VA benefits. They will also be in a position to provide instructions on how to make claims before the statute of limitations expires.

A good mesothelioma lawyer will provide a no-cost case assessment so you can determine if you're eligible to bring an action or file a trust fund claim. Furthermore, top law firms will not charge you upfront fees to evaluate your case, since they work on an on a contingency basis. This means that they will only be paid if you are awarded compensation. This is not only a great way to prioritize your needs, this arrangement is also a cost-effective way to ensure the highest amount of compensation.

4. Flexibility

People who suffer from asbestos-related illnesses or mesothelioma can claim compensation from the companies who exposed them to the carcinogen. Compensation can cover future and past medical expenses, lost income along with pain and suffering as well as funeral expenses.

A skilled mesothelioma lawyer can identify all parties liable for your damages and assist you through the lawsuit or settlement process. Asbestos-related illness claims are often complex and can take years to resolve. An experienced attorney will fight for you and your loved ones until justice is obtained.

The best mesothelioma lawyers will have the expertise and resources required to maximize the value of your case. A lawyer's history of fighting for victims of asbestos exposure will give you peace of mind that he or she is the ideal choice to handle your claim.

Asbestos lawyers are known to get millions of dollars in settlements for their clients. They are also known to obtain substantial verdicts in trials. Certain mesothelioma lawyers specialize in asbestos-related cases. others have a wide range of practice areas and concentrate on representing people with different types of illnesses.

Once you've compiled a list of potential candidates, you can schedule an interview with them personally. Bring your work history along with medical records, as well as any other pertinent information to the meeting. Ask the lawyers how they expect your case to go and what the typical timeframe is for the resolution. Be sure to inquire about costs and fees.
